Что такое refactor:dotnet?
Выполните рефакторинг кода ASP.NET Core/C#, чтобы улучшить удобство обслуживания, читаемость и соответствие передовым практикам. Преобразует толстые контроллеры, дублирующийся код и устаревшие шаблоны в чистый современный код .NET. Применяет такие функции C# 12, как первичные конструкторы и выражения коллекций, принципы SOLID, шаблоны чистой архитектуры и правильное внедрение зависимостей. Выявляет и исправляет антишаблоны, включая локатор сервисов, зависимые зависимости и отсутствующие шаблоны асинхронности/ожидания. Источник: snakeo/claude-debug-and-refactor-skills-plugin.